Resumen

With a viability score of 58/100, this business falls in the medium bucket and shows potential but with meaningful execution risk. Revenue could reach $8,400–$14,400/month, yet profits are highly variable ($168–$4,788/month) and the break-even window is wide at 9–239 months.

Plan de ejecución

  1. Differentiate the studio with a clear niche (e.g., prenatal, beginners, corporate stress relief) tailored to Huancayo demand
  2. Build a pre-launch membership pipeline (waitlist + class intro packs) to fill capacity in month one
  3. Set tiered pricing and retention offers (monthly memberships, 10-class packs, student/early-bird rates) to stabilize the $8,400–$14,400 revenue range
  4. Optimize class scheduling and instructor utilization to target the low end of profit ($168/month) moving toward the high end ($4,788/month)
  5. Track unit economics weekly (new leads, conversion, churn, average class attendance, CAC) to shorten the break-even path from the upper risk range
  6. Launch local partnerships in Huancayo (gyms, clinics, employers, coworking spaces) to reduce reliance on walk-ins
